AN ORDINANCE
AUTHORIZING THE CITY MANAGER TO EXECUTE A LEASE AGREEMENT
WITH JOSE F. VELA, JR., FOR SPACE LOCATED AT 105 NORTH ASH
IN BISHOP, TEXAS, FOR AN INITIAL TERM OF TWO YEARS WITH AN
OPTION TO RENEW FOR AN ADDITIONAL TWO YEARS, FOR USE AS A
TITLE III NUTRITION PROGRAM MEAL SITE AND SOCIAL SERVICE
CENTER UNDER THE SENIOR_COMMUNITY SERVICES PROGRAM, ALL
AS MORE FULLY SET FORTH IN THE LEASE AGREEMENT, A SUBSTAN-
TIAL COPY OF WHICH IS ATTACHED HERETO AND MADE A PART HEREOF,
MARKED EXHIBIT "A",; AND DECLARING AN EMERGENCY.
BE IT ORDAINED BY TH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F CORPUS CHRISTI,
TEXAS:
SECTION 1. That the City Manager be and he is hereby authorized to
execute a lease agreement with Jose F. Vela, Jr., for space located at 105
North Ash, Bishop, Texas, for an initial term of two years with an option to
renew for an additional two years, for use as a Title III Nutrition Program
Meal Site and Social Service Center under the Senior Community Services
Program, all as more fully set forth in the lease agreement, a substantial
copy of which is attached hereto and made a part hereof, marked Exhibit "A".
SECTION 2. That upon written request of the Mayor or five Council
members, copy attached, to find and declare an emergency due to the need for
executing the aforesaid lease agreement in order to provide meal site and
social center for the Senior Community Services Program, such finding of an
emergency is made and declared requiring suspension of the Charter rule as to
consideration and voting upon ordinances or resolutions at three regular
meetings so that this ordinance is passed and shall take effect upon first
reading as an emergency measure this the -34 day of February, 1982.

LEASE AGREEMENT
THE STATE OF TEXAS
COUNTY OF NUECES
This agreement is entered into by and between Jose F. Vela, Jr.,
524 E. Alice, Kingsville, Texas, hereinafter called LESSOR, and the City of
Corpus Christi, a municipal corporation located in Corpus Christi, Nueces
County, Texas, hereinafter called LESSEE, acting by and through Ernest M.
Briones, Acting City Manager, for the use and occupancy of the below described
premises, under the following terms:
ARTICLE I
Terms of the Lease
A. The terms of this lease shall be for two years, commencing
December 28, 1981, and ending December 27, 1983, unless terminated prior
to that date as hereinafter provided. Lessor hereby leases to Lessee the
land and improvements located at 105 North Ash, Bishop, Texas, hereinafter
called "leased premises."
B. The Lessee has the option to renew this lease for a further
period of two years in one-year increments on the same rental terms by giv-
ing Lessor thirty days written notice of its election to do so.
C. Either party may terminate this lease upon thirty days written
notice to the other party.
D. On the date of termination of this lease, Lessee agrees to
surrender the property covered by this lease,and all permanent improvements
placed on the property by Lessee shall become the property of Lessor.
E. Lessor will make the following improvements prior to occupancy
by Lessee:
1. Two restrooms will be fully functional by the date of
occupancy. Improvements will be necessary to the plumb-
ing and to the interior of the restrooms. Interior
improvements will include lighting and any necessary
painting and sheetrock work.
2. Handwashing facilities will be available in each rest-
room.
3. The exterior hall leading to the restroom will be fully
enclosed and lighted.
4. Plumbing will be inspected to meet building code require-
ments.
5. Front and back doors will be replaced with solid core -
doors and double locks.
6. Electrical wiring will be inspected to meet building
code requirements.
7. Four electrical outlets will be installed; two will
be 220 voltage and two will be 120 voltage.
8. Electrical lighting fixtures will be replaced.
9. The premises wi31 be cleared of all debris.
ARTICLE II
Compensation
A. In consideration for the lease, the Lessee shall pay Lessor
the sum of One Hundred Eighty -Five Dollars ($185.00) each month for the
duration of the lease.
B. Lessee will be responsible for paying all utilities used in
connection with the lease.
ARTICLE III
Use
A. The leased premises are to be used by Lessee as a Senior
Citizens Center during the hours of 9:00 a.m. to 3:00 p.m., Monday through
Friday, to offer nutrition services, social services, and recreational
services to the elderly residents of Bishop, Texas.
B. Lessee may share the leased premises with other agencies as
requested by Lessee but Lessee will be responsible for the activities of
such other agencies and may restrict such activities if not in keeping
with policies of Lessee.
ARTICLE IV
Indemnification
A. Lessor indemnifies and holds harmless Lessee against any and
all liability incurred as result of Lessor's failure to make necessary
repairs to the demised premises or as result of Lessor's negligence in not
making any necessary repairs to the premises.
B. Lessee shall maintain sufficient liability insurance to cover
injury or damage caused to property or persons on the leased premises
during normal operating hours. Lessee will indemnify and hold Lessor harm-
less from liability for damages which are proximately caused by the negligence
of Lessee or its staff.
-2-
C. Lessee agrees to comply with all ordinances and regulations
of the City and other governmental agencies which are applicable to the use
of the leased premises during the term of this lease.
ARTICLE V
Right to Access
Lessor shall have the right of access, at reasonable times, for
examining said premises and for making necessary repairs, and shall be
limited to such activities unless prior notice is given Lessee.
ARTICLE VI
Obligations
Lessee shall at its expense, excepting those expenses over Fifty
Dollars ($50), maintain and keep the premises and electrical fixtures in
good repair and good condition. Lessor shall have completed all major repairs
before occupancy by Lessee. Major repairs shall be made at expense of Lessor.
For purposes of this:lease, major repairs are defined as those costing in
excess of Fifty Dollars ($50), and must be completed within five working days
after reported to Lessor. Major repairs delayed beyond the period specified
may be performed by Lessee with reimbursement therefor to be made to Lessee
by Lessor.
